Jack Billings is going to be a great player but he may not place in the top 5 from his draft cohort.
But he will certainly be top 10.
Although the AFL would have you believe that Billings was the 3rd draft pick in the 2013 National Draft
Jack Martin (Gold Coast)
Jesse Hogan (Melbourne)
who otherwise would have been included in the the draft were taken earlier as under age players via the 2012 mini draft.
GWS had the first 2 picks in the 2013 draft due to Melbourne swapping pick 2 for pick 9 and Dom Tyson.
Tom Boyd (GWS 1)
Josh Kelly (GWS 2)
But then you get to choose from the likes of
Jack Billings (St Kilda 3)
Marcus Bontempelli (Dogs 4)
Kade Kolodjashnij (Gold Coast 5)
James Aish (Brisbane 7)
Nathan Freeman (Collingwood 10)
Dom Sheed (West Coast 11)
Patrick Cripps (Carlton 13)
Cameron McCarthy (GWS 14)
Zach Merrett (Essendon 26)
Lewis Taylor (Brisbane 28)
Ben Brown (North 47)
Now if you want to be able to make the realistic pick 5 again then you must allow the 2 mini draft and 2 national draft picks to be made again.
Bontempelli would be gone before your pick 5.
You may not choose Billings but he would certainly go top 10.
